The JT-60SA experiment will be the world´s largest superconducting tokamak when it is assembled in Naka, Japan (R = 3 m, a = 1.2 m). This paper describes the approach taken to define appropriate manufacturing tolerances and metrology points for each toroidal field (TF) coil and in particular the proposed procedure for the final assembly of the TF magnet system.
